KLDiscovery Inc. Announces Agreement to Acquire Cenza Technologies to Establish Global Delivery Center in India

Cenza

Cenza is an established global ALSP serving clients in the US and UK from India with scalable, cost‐effective, and reliable managed legal services built on best‐in‐class technology, deep operational expertise, rigorous quality control, and robust client service.

KLDiscovery Inc. Completes Acquisition of Cenza Technologies Private Limited

Cenza

(“KLD”), a leading global provider of electronic discovery, information governance, and data recovery services, today announced the closing of their previously announced acquisition of the business of Cenza Technologies Private Limited (“Cenza”), an India-based alternative legal services provider (“ALSP”).
